基础概念
亚马逊Mac1专用主机(Amazon EC2 Mac Instances)是亚马逊云服务(AWS)提供的一种特殊类型的计算实例,专为需要macOS环境的开发人员设计。这些实例允许用户在云端运行macOS,适用于iOS、macOS、watchOS和tvOS应用的开发和测试。
相关优势
- 无需本地macOS设备:开发者可以在云端进行开发和测试,无需购买和维护昂贵的本地macOS设备。
- 弹性扩展:根据需求轻松扩展或缩减资源,节省成本。
- 高可用性和可靠性:AWS提供的高可用性和可靠性确保开发环境的稳定。
- 集成开发工具:与AWS的其他服务集成,提供全面的开发工具链。
类型
亚马逊Mac1专用主机主要有以下几种类型:
- mac1.metal:单租户、裸金属实例,提供最高的性能和安全性。
应用场景
- iOS和macOS应用开发:开发者可以在云端进行应用的开发和测试。
- 持续集成/持续部署(CI/CD):自动化构建、测试和部署流程。
- 多媒体处理:利用macOS的多媒体处理能力进行视频编辑和音频处理。
问题分析
您的亚马逊Mac1专用主机处于挂起状态,无法创建Mac实例,可能是由以下原因导致的:
- 资源不足:AWS可能没有足够的资源来分配新的Mac实例。
- 配额限制:您的AWS账户可能达到了某些资源的配额限制。
- 区域或可用区问题:特定区域或可用区可能存在问题,导致无法创建实例。
- 权限问题:您的AWS账户可能没有足够的权限来创建Mac实例。
解决方法
- 检查资源可用性:
- 检查资源可用性:
- 这个命令可以帮助您检查mac1.metal实例类型的可用性。
- 检查配额限制:
登录AWS管理控制台,导航到“服务配额”页面,检查是否有相关的配额限制。
- 选择其他区域或可用区:
尝试在其他区域或可用区创建Mac实例,看看是否能解决问题。
- 检查权限:
确保您的AWS账户有足够的权限来创建Mac实例。您可以通过以下命令检查IAM策略:
- 检查权限:
确保您的AWS账户有足够的权限来创建Mac实例。您可以通过以下命令检查IAM策略:
- 联系AWS支持:
如果以上方法都无法解决问题,建议联系AWS支持团队,获取进一步的帮助。
参考链接
希望这些信息能帮助您解决问题。如果需要进一步的帮助,请随时联系AWS支持团队。